Uniinfo Telecom Q2 FY26: Profit Swing Masks Persistent Operational Weakness
Uniinfo Telecom Services Ltd., a micro-cap telecom equipment and accessories company with a market capitalisation of ₹18.00 crores, reported a net profit of ₹0.14 crores in Q2 FY26, marking a dramatic turnaround from a loss of ₹0.21 crores in the same quarter last year. The 600.00% quarter-on-quarter surge, however, comes off an extremely low base of ₹0.02 crores in Q1 FY26, highlighting the company's persistent struggle with profitability and scale. Despite the headline profit swing, the stock has plunged 51.40% over the past year, reflecting deep investor scepticism about the company's long-term viability and operational sustainability.
How has been the historical performance of Uniinfo Telecom?
Uniinfo Telecom has experienced a declining trend in financial performance, with net sales dropping from 49.90 Cr in Mar'24 to 33.34 Cr in Mar'25, and profitability turning negative, resulting in a profit after tax of -0.69 Cr. The company also faced increased liabilities and negative cash flow from operations in the latest fiscal year.
